India, Russia Enter Talks to Co-Develop Next-Gen BrahMos Missile Following Operation Sindoor Success

India and Russia have initiated formal discussions to jointly develop an advanced version of the BrahMos supersonic cruise missile, signaling a strategic step forward in regional defense cooperation. According to a report by Firstpost, the dialogue follows the successful use of BrahMos missiles during India’s recent Operation Sindoor—a high-stakes military campaign that highlighted the missile’s precision and effectiveness in real-time combat scenarios.

Defense analysts view the move as a significant affirmation of India’s growing indigenous defense capabilities, reinforced by Russian technological expertise. The upcoming variant is expected to boast extended range, improved targeting systems, and greater speed, potentially bolstering India’s strategic arsenal.

The collaboration underscores the enduring defense partnership between New Delhi and Moscow amidst evolving global geopolitical conditions. Senior officials from both countries are currently outlining the next phase of development under the BrahMos Aerospace joint venture, with design and testing frameworks likely to be finalized in the coming months. If successful, the next-generation BrahMos missile could play a pivotal role in India’s deterrence and rapid-response infrastructure.

🇮🇳 Indian housewives hold 11% of the world's gold, surpassing the combined reserves of the USA, Russia, France, Italy, Germany, and Switzerland, appears accurate based on recent data.

📊
Indian women hold about 24,000 tons of gold, roughly 11% of the global total (216,265 tons). The combined reserves of the listed countries total around 19,752 tons (USA: 8,133, Russia: 2,336, France: 2,437, Italy: 2,452, Germany: 3,355, Switzerland: 1,040). Thus, 24,000 tons exceeds 19,752 tons. While exact figures may vary slightly by source or year, the evidence supports the claim.

#TrumpTariffs Donald Trump's approach to India, particularly regarding trade, has been characterized by a focus on "reciprocal tariffs" and reducing the US trade deficit. He has often labeled India a "tariff king," despite India's average tariffs being compliant with WTO rules.
His administration has applied tariffs, including a 26% reciprocal duty on Indian exports like steel and auto parts. While some sectors like pharmaceuticals and semiconductors were initially spared, there's ongoing pressure. Trump has also publicly criticized Apple for manufacturing iPhones in India, threatening tariffs if production isn't moved to the US.
These policies have created uncertainty but also spurred India to seek bilateral trade agreements and diversify its export markets, aiming to mitigate potential economic impacts. The trade relationship remains a key, albeit sometimes contentious, aspect of US-India ties.
